我们提出一种名为 QD-MAPPER 的通用框架,利用质量多样性(QD)算法结合神经元胞自动机(NCA),自动生成具有不同结构模式的多样地图,用于全面评估多智能体路径规划(MAPF)算法。以往研究通常在少量人工设计的地图上测试算法,易导致算法过拟合特定场景。QD-MAPPER 能生成覆盖广泛场景的地图,支持对搜索类、优先级类、规则类和学习类等不同类型 MAPF 算法的系统性评估。通过单算法分析与算法间对比实验,研究人员可发现各算法的优势模式,并揭示其在运行时间与成功率上的差异,为算法选择与改进提供依据。

We use the Quality Diversity (QD) algorithm with Neural Cellular Automata (NCA) to automatically evaluate Multi-Agent Path Finding (MAPF) algorithms by generating diverse maps. Previously, researchers typically evaluate MAPF algorithms on a set of specific, human-designed maps at their initial stage of algorithm design. However, such fixed maps may not cover all scenarios, and algorithms may overfit to the small set of maps. To seek further improvements, systematic evaluations on a diverse suite of maps are needed. In this work, we propose Quality-Diversity Multi-Agent Path Finding Performance EvaluatoR (QD-MAPPER), a general framework that takes advantage of the QD algorithm to comprehensively understand the performance of MAPF algorithms by generating maps with patterns, be able to make fair comparisons between two MAPF algorithms, providing further information on the selection between two algorithms and on the design of the algorithms. Empirically, we employ this technique to evaluate and compare the behavior of different types of MAPF algorithms, including search-based, priority-based, rule-based, and learning-based algorithms. Through both single-algorithm experiments and comparisons between algorithms, researchers can identify patterns that each MAPF algorithm excels and detect disparities in runtime or success rates between different algorithms.
